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2012.03.11;
Скачать: [xml.tar.bz2];

Вниз

bde,paradox. Связь одной таблицы с двумя родительскими   Найти похожие ветки 

 
YanKl ©   (2010-04-30 22:09) [0]

Собственно, как связать одну таблицу по двум индексам с двумя родительскими?

Заранее спасибо.


 
turbouser ©   (2010-04-30 22:12) [1]


> YanKl ©   (30.04.10 22:09)  

Забудь про Paradox.
Пожалуйста.


 
YanKl ©   (2010-04-30 22:15) [2]

Сразу после решения этой проблемы. Оно ведь существует? :)


 
Германн ©   (2010-05-01 02:58) [3]


> YanKl ©   (30.04.10 22:15) [2]
>
> Сразу после решения этой проблемы.

Лучше ДО.
А вообще, лично мне непонятен сабж.
Что и как нужно связать?


 
Виталий Панасенко(дом)   (2010-05-01 10:43) [4]

Св-во MasterSource - одно единственное, как и MasterFields.. дальше понятно?


 
dik   (2010-05-01 11:34) [5]

Очень интересная задача!
Бывает один ко многим, бывает многие ко многим, но чтобы многие к одному...?
Однажды мне поставили такую задачу (правда постановщик была женщина и химик), я её так и не решил, на все мои увещенавния был один ответ: "А мне так надо!"


 
Loginov Dmitry ©   (2010-05-01 11:43) [6]


> Забудь про Paradox.
> Пожалуйста.


+1

Тем более нигде нет более запутанной, более сложной, и более глючной реализации связи Master/Detail, чем при использовании Paradox.


 
turbouser ©   (2010-05-01 11:51) [7]


> dik   (01.05.10 11:34) [5]


> я её так и не решил

Ты не поверишь, но приходилось решать гораааздо более заковыристые задачи и они решались. Сказали - надо! Значит надо. Если не справляешься - нет работы, так шта вот :))))


 
Виталий Панасенко(дом)   (2010-05-01 13:23) [8]


> turbouser ©   (01.05.10 11:51) [7]

и как ты решишь эту? просто интересно. у меня мыслей нету. только решение в буквальном, поставленном автором, варианте...


 
sniknik ©   (2010-05-01 13:47) [9]

> и как ты решишь эту? ... в буквальном, поставленном автором, варианте...
берешь ту таблицу что нужно "связать", считаешь родительской ее...  делаешь обычную связь, один ко многим. после меняешь таблицы (вернее гриды их отображающие) местами (но не связи!). теперь считаешь что родительская это "та которая слева".
готово. это если в прямом авторском варианте...

если же нужно в прямом по смыслу, т.е. дочерняя зависела  от 2х родителей, и соответственно представляла набор данных в зависимости от выбранных 2х записей из 2х таблиц...
тоже не невозможно. но только связь придется "руками" делать, т.е. берешь индексное значение из одной таблицы, из другой, и делаешь по ним фильтр дочерней таблице. одна обработка в онченде рекорд...


 
turbouser ©   (2010-05-01 14:04) [10]


> Виталий Панасенко(дом)   (01.05.10 13:23) [8]


> и как ты решишь эту?

Оно мне надо?


 
Плохиш ©   (2010-05-03 11:11) [11]

Может у меня версии bde всегда были не правильные, но они всегда поддерживали sql на уровне, описанном в localsql.hlp.


 
Anatoly Podgoretsky ©   (2010-05-03 11:18) [12]

И его более чем достаточнее для решения задачи.



Страницы: 1 вся ветка

Форум: "Базы";
Текущий архив: 2012.03.11;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.47 MB
Время: 0.004 c
2-1322641073
_qwerty_
2011-11-30 12:17
2012.03.11
работа с bookmark


2-1321812059
spbstu_helpme
2011-11-20 22:00
2012.03.11
delphi численное интегрирование


2-1322555028
Cobalt
2011-11-29 12:23
2012.03.11
IFDEF, не та версия?


15-1321859139
OW
2011-11-21 11:05
2012.03.11
Опять не понимаю логику Oracle


2-1322608424
vit196sh
2011-11-30 03:13
2012.03.11
Помогите с несложной программой пожалуйста)))





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ский